Grieving Mother Makes Teddy Bears Out Of Fallen Soldiers’ Uniforms

For Lisa Freeman, the healing begins with her hands; when she received the horrible news that her son Matthew had been killed in Afghanistan, she was heartbroken and understandably had no idea what to do next.

Matthew was a proud member of the Marine Corps, so it was a shock to his whole family when they heard that he had been killed in action only nine days into his tour of duty. While his mother took some time to grieve, it wasn't until she held his uniform in her arms that she was suddenly struck with a wonderful idea. She rushed to her sewing machine, and got to work.

After she was finished stitching everything together she looked at what she had made: a beautiful teddy bear using her own son's camouflage uniform. While Matthew was gone, she had certainly came up with a heartwarming way to keep him near to her for the rest of her life.

While the story would usually end there, someone else had heard of this heartbreaking story. With so many homes with missing members who have died in service to our country, Lisa realized she could be a great help in the healing process of so many wounded families.
